How to use zzzKAI/Qwen2-VL-2B-Instruct-SFT with Transformers:
# Use a pipeline as a high-level helper
from transformers import pipeline
pipe = pipeline("image-text-to-text", model="zzzKAI/Qwen2-VL-2B-Instruct-SFT")
messages = [
{
"role": "user",
"content": [
{"type": "image", "url": "https://huggingface.co/datasets/huggingface/documentation-images/resolve/main/p-blog/candy.JPG"},
{"type": "text", "text": "What animal is on the candy?"}
]
},
]
pipe(text=messages) # Load model directly
from transformers import AutoProcessor, AutoModelForImageTextToText
processor = AutoProcessor.from_pretrained("zzzKAI/Qwen2-VL-2B-Instruct-SFT")
model = AutoModelForImageTextToText.from_pretrained("zzzKAI/Qwen2-VL-2B-Instruct-SFT")
messages = [
{
"role": "user",
"content": [
{"type": "image", "url": "https://huggingface.co/datasets/huggingface/documentation-images/resolve/main/p-blog/candy.JPG"},
{"type": "text", "text": "What animal is on the candy?"}
]
},
]
inputs = processor.apply_chat_template(
messages,
add_generation_prompt=True,
tokenize=True,
return_dict=True,
return_tensors="pt",
).to(model.device)
outputs = model.generate(**inputs, max_new_tokens=40)
print(processor.decode(outputs[0][inputs["input_ids"].shape[-1]:]))How to use zzzKAI/Qwen2-VL-2B-Instruct-SFT with vLLM:

This model is a fine-tuned version of Qwen/Qwen2-VL-2B-Instruct on the MMInstruction/Clevr_CoGenT_TrainA_R1 dataset. It has been trained using TRL.
from transformers import pipeline
question = "If you had a time machine, but could only go to the past or the future once and never return, which would you choose and why?"
generator = pipeline("text-generation", model="zzzKAI/Qwen2-VL-2B-Instruct-SFT", device="cuda")
output = generator([{"role": "user", "content": question}], max_new_tokens=128, return_full_text=False)[0]
print(output["generated_text"])
This model was trained with SFT.
